A kayaking trip through the St. Sebastian River takes you back in time as you paddle through “Old Florida” and under large canopy oaks. You’ll not only discover birds, alligators, manatees, turtles but also a sense of peace. Kayaking the Sebastian River Area is a great escape for those seeking relaxation while learning to appreciate Florida’s natural wonderlands.

ELIGIBILITY CRITERIA
In order to participate in this program, one:
- Everyone using rental equipment must wear a life jacket at all times.
- Must not exceed the manufacturer’s weight limit for the vessel (450 lbs. tandem kayak or 275 lbs. single kayak).
- Must have the ability to follow verbal and/or visual instructions independently or with the assistance of a companion.
- Must have the ability to wear a properly fitted personal flotation device.
- Must have the ability to enter and exit the kayak independently or with the assistance of a companion or with the use of adaptive equipment.
- Must have At least one person in the kayak with the ability to move it through the water in a stable manner and return it to the launching area.
- Must have the ability to tolerate 80 degree Fahrenheit water and bright sunlight for 1.5 hours.
In the event of capsize, one:
- Must have the ability to get out from under the watercraft independently.
- Must have the ability to right oneself and remain face up in the water with the aid of a personal flotation device.
